Bhagyashree, who played Maine Pyar Kiya in Maine Pyar Kiya, made a hit with her debut film in 1989, but she left the industry shortly after. The film that began Bhagyashree’s career, directed by Sooraj Barjatya and starring Salman Khan, made everyone a star, but Bhagyashree’s choice to stay away from the spotlight stunned her followers. Bhagyashree has been asked many times over the years if she regrets her decision.

According to Bhagyashree, she has been answering the same question for over 33 years. This question is frequently asked of her children, actresses Abhimanyu Dasani and Avantika Dasani. Her children, Bhagyashree stated, “laugh at this.” “Everyone asks him the same question over and over,” she alleged Abhimanyu told her.

When pressed further, Bhagyashree stated that she had the “chance to care after my family and my house” at the time. Bhagyashree has taken on a few projects in the previous several years. She recently appeared in the films Radhe Shyam and Thalaivii. She and her husband Himalaya were also featured in the reality program Smart Jodi.

“My children are the wind behind my wings,” Bhagyashree stated when asked if she regretted her decision. So, no regrets since I consider myself to have had the best of both worlds.”

Bhagyashree is slated to return to television as a judge on the reality programme DID Super Moms, with Urmila Matondkar and Remo D’Souza. “DID Super Moms is coming back after seven years, and the creators wanted a spectacular comeback,” a source previously told indianexpress.com. Urmila and Bhagyashree were both excellent choices for the show. Everything simply worked out since they were both eager to cheer for all the mothers out there. Remo was invited on board since he was one of DID’s faces.”
